From the Acting Headmaster Cancer Council’s Biggest Morning Tea Thank you to all of our staff members and students who came together yesterday to support the Cancer Research Foundation and “Australia’s Biggest Morning Tea”. The School raised over $700 towards the fight against cancer, with the money going to fund research and to provide support services to patients and their families. A special thank you to our Health and Wellbeing Committee and our Prefects for organising this very worthy event. Thank you also to all of our students and staff who supplied a delicious array of treats for the morning tea. Several of our boys displayed outstanding baking skills and their wares were most appreciated.

Balwyn Rotary Club Public Speaking Competition Philip Alex (Year 11) won his way through to the Grand Final of the Balwyn Rotary Club’s public speaking competition last week. Out of nine schools represented (Strathcona, MLC, Scotch, Xavier, Camberwell Girls Grammar School, Camberwell High School, Fintona, Genazzano and Siena) four speakers will ‘speak off’ next Tuesday night at a Gala Dinner. Philip was able to speak without the aid of cue cards on the topic ‘The Dying Art of Conversation’. Congratulations to Philip and best wishes for next week’s Grand Final.
